Log Message:
-----------
Add configure options to point the build at Apple libc and XNU source,
required to find private headers on Mac OS X.

Use AC_ARG_ENABLE instead of AC_ARG_WITH for functional frobs, such as
legacy API, libdispatch_init constructor tagging, Apple-specific TSD
and semaphore optimizations, as well as new settings such as the use of
crashreporter_info.

Locate MIG on Mac OS X, as we need it to build protocols.def.

Use pthread_workqueue.h to decide whether to define
HAVE_PTHREAD_WORKQUEUES.  We may want to offer a --disable frob for this
on Mac OS X.
